PURPOSE:To obtain a resin composition outstanding in waterproofness even when subjected to various conditions of heat cycles, by blending a crystalline resin with a melting temperature higher than a specified value containing vinylidene fluoride and another resin having a melting temperature different from that of the former resin. CONSTITUTION:The objective composition can be obtained by blending (A) 50-20wt.% of a crystalline resin with a melting temperature >=120 deg.C containing >=70wt.% of vinylidene fluoride (e.g., hexafluoropropylene-vinylidene fluoride copolymer) and (B) 50-30wt.% of a resin with a melting temperature <=100 deg.C (e.g., a crystalline resin containing <=70wt. of vinylidene fluoride, ethylene-vinyl acetate copolymer). This composition, comprising two kinds of resins mutually differing in melting temperatures, is outstanding in water resistance since these resins effectively compensate the gap developed, even under severe conditions of combination of heat cycle and chemical exposure.
